Embroidery Quilting Craft Sewing Machines Buttonhole-Stitch, Embroidery & Cross Stitch Supplies, Cross Stitch Embroidery … WebFig 1: Work the Blanket Stitch till you approach the corner. Fig 2: For a sharp corner, make one of the stitches to pass through the corner points as shown. Fig 3: Then, turn and work the rest of the way normally. If your corner seems to slip off (which can happen in big Blanket Stitches), just anchor down the corner with a small stitch.

WebFeb 8, 2024 · 1. Any buttonhole stitch consists of two levels: the top one and the bottom one. When working Tailor's buttonhole stitch, bring your thread at the starting point of the top level, then insert the needle close to that point on the same level, and bring it out again at the bottom line, with your needle lying on a vertical line.
